Tiny A-Frame Romantic Getaway

Camp Lupine is a brand new Luxury 400 sq ft Tiny A-Frame tucked away on a private wooded lot with a small stream just a quarter mile off Coastal Route 1. With Historic Wiscasset, Booth Bay, Bath, Freeport, and Portland all at your fingertips, it’s the perfect romantic getaway. Spend your days exploring coastal Maine and your nights soaking in the hot tub with a glass of Malbec. Stay for a while and explore the growing restaurant scene in Wiscasset and the entire Midcoast region.

The space
Our Tiny A-Frame is designed like a 400 sq ft. luxury hotel suite with everything you need to enjoy your vacation. Custom built by Amish craftsmen in Pennsylvania then delivered to Maine, this modern A-Frame Tiny Home by Zook cabins is modern in design but built by hand to last many decades.
Tucked away in its own secluded woods, but still just minutes away from some of Maine's best restaurants and beaches. The oversized 200 sq ft. gazebo covers a natural stone patio, top of the line Weber Spirit grill, reclining swinging sofa, concrete propane firepit, patio dining set, and of course our custom cedar hot tub. Barbecue for dinner and then soak with the massaging jets in the hot tub for the evening while the fire crackles in the background.
Stroll down the path to the back of the property and sip your morning coffee in our Adirondack chairs while overlooking the quiet stream that runs through the wetlands nearby. Sit out at dusk and you will can often see deer or other wildlife grazing across the stream.
Inside you will find an efficient but surprisingly spacious interior. Curl up on the couch to our complimentary Netflix, HBO, and basic cable with a glass of wine. Spend the morning basking in the incredible forest view through the massive A-Frame window. The kitchen, while compact, is perfect for making all of your favorite meals, and with the nearest supermarket only five minutes away its easy to replenish groceries regularly.
The bedroom features a premium king sized mattress with a memory foam topper and spotless white all cotton sheets. Finally you will find the ensuite bathroom which has a full shower and vanity with all the essentials you may need for your trip.

Please note that the driveway is paved and plowed but it is fairly steep so please be aware!

About the area

Wiscasset

Wiscasset is home to Tiny A-Frame Romantic Getaway. The area's natural beauty can be seen at Ovens Mouth Preserve and Whaleback Shell Midden State Historic Site, while Lincoln County Jail Museum and Markings Gallery are cultural highlights. Bath Center for the Arts and Chocolate Church Arts Center are also worth visiting.
